Job Overview

The Director of Business Development is the primary face of the company in the UK market, focused on identifying and closing new business and managing existing relationships for continued success.  In this capacity, the Director participates in meetings and presentations promoting the benefits of globalizing a company’s talent base and the unique aspects of Relay’s model.  In addition to direct meetings, the Director participates in industry events and conferences to promote the company and its brand.  The position also involves significant work relating to identifying target customers and partners, maintaining accurate and complete sales information, and working collaboratively with counterparts in Asia and North America.
